news 2026/6/10 22:36:31

Hunyuan模型如何省钱?HY-MT1.8B Spot实例部署实战

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Hunyuan模型如何省钱?HY-MT1.8B Spot实例部署实战

Hunyuan模型如何省钱?HY-MT1.8B Spot实例部署实战

1. 引言:企业级翻译需求与成本挑战

在多语言业务快速扩展的背景下,高质量、低延迟的机器翻译能力已成为全球化服务的核心基础设施。腾讯混元团队推出的HY-MT1.5-1.8B模型,凭借其18亿参数量和对38种语言的支持,在翻译质量上已接近主流大模型水平,尤其在中英互译任务中表现突出(BLEU Score达41.2)。然而,高性能也意味着高昂的推理成本——若使用标准GPU云实例持续运行,月均费用可能超过万元。

本文聚焦于一个关键问题:如何以最低成本实现HY-MT1.8B模型的稳定在线服务?答案是采用Spot实例 + 容器化部署 + 自动恢复机制的组合策略。通过利用云平台闲置资源提供的大幅折扣(最高可达70%),结合自动化运维手段,我们可在保障服务质量的同时显著降低部署成本。

本实践基于CSDN AI云环境完成,适用于希望将Hunyuan系列模型用于生产环境但预算有限的技术团队。

2. 技术方案选型:为何选择Spot实例?

2.1 标准实例 vs Spot实例对比

维度标准GPU实例Spot GPU实例
价格全价(如A100 ¥6.8/h)折扣价(低至¥2.0/h,降幅超70%)
稳定性高,长期可用中,可能被回收(通常提前5分钟通知)
适用场景生产核心服务可容忍短暂中断的服务、批处理任务
成本效益极高
启动速度

从表格可见,Spot实例的核心优势在于极致的成本控制,特别适合以下场景: - 推理服务可接受短时中断(<5分钟) - 具备自动重启与状态恢复能力 - 流量非全天高峰,存在低谷期可配合调度

对于翻译这类“请求-响应”模式的服务,只要前端具备重试机制或用户可接受短暂等待,Spot实例完全能满足大多数业务需求。

2.2 HY-MT1.8B模型特性适配分析

HY-MT1.8B模型具有如下特点,使其非常适合Spot部署:

  • 无状态服务:每次翻译请求独立,不依赖历史上下文(除对话模板外),便于实例重建后无缝接入。
  • 加载时间可控:模型约3.8GB,A100实例冷启动加载时间约90秒,配合缓存优化可进一步缩短。
  • 支持分布式部署:可通过Gradio或FastAPI暴露REST接口,轻松集成负载均衡器。

因此,将HY-MT1.8B部署于Spot实例,在技术上可行且经济性极佳

3. 实战部署:从镜像到高可用服务

3.1 环境准备与镜像获取

首先确保你拥有支持Spot实例的AI云平台账户(如CSDN星图AI云)。推荐配置为: - GPU类型:NVIDIA A100 或 V100 - 显存:≥20GB - 操作系统:Ubuntu 20.04 LTS - 存储:≥10GB SSD(用于缓存模型)

获取官方预构建镜像(由113小贝二次开发优化):

docker pull registry.csdn.net/hunyuan/hy-mt-1.8b:latest

该镜像已集成以下优化: - PyTorch 2.1 + Transformers 4.56.0 编译加速 - 分词器与模型权重预下载(避免每次拉取Hugging Face) - 启动脚本自动检测GPU并分配设备

3.2 Docker容器化部署流程

步骤一:创建持久化存储目录
mkdir -p /data/hy-mt-models cp -r /path/to/HY-MT1.5-1.8B/* /data/hy-mt-models/ chmod -R 755 /data/hy-mt-models

确保模型文件持久化,防止实例回收后重新下载。

步骤二:编写启动脚本start_server.sh
#!/bin/bash # 自动重试启动服务 while true; do echo "[$(date)] Starting HY-MT1.8B server..." docker run --rm --gpus all \ -p 7860:7860 \ -v /data/hy-mt-models:/app/HY-MT1.5-1.8B \ --name hy-mt-translator \ registry.csdn.net/hunyuan/hy-mt-1.8b:latest \ python3 /HY-MT1.5-1.8B/app.py # 若容器退出,等待10秒后重启 sleep 10 done

此脚本保证即使Spot实例被回收,也能在新实例上自动恢复服务。

步骤三:后台运行服务
chmod +x start_server.sh nohup ./start_server.sh > translator.log 2>&1 &

日志将记录在translator.log中,可用于监控运行状态。

3.3 Web服务调用示例

服务启动后,可通过HTTP请求进行翻译调用。以下是Python客户端示例:

import requests import json def translate(text, src="en", tgt="zh"): url = "http://localhost:7860/api/predict" data = { "data": [ f"Translate from {src} to {tgt}: {text}", "", # history "" # system_prompt ] } try: response = requests.post(url, data=json.dumps(data), timeout=30) if response.status_code == 200: result = response.json()["data"][0] return result.strip() else: return f"Error: {response.status_code}" except Exception as e: return f"Request failed: {str(e)}" # 使用示例 print(translate("It's on the house.")) # 输出:这是免费的。

注意:Gradio默认接口路径为/api/predict,需根据实际部署调整URL。

4. 成本优化与稳定性增强策略

4.1 Spot实例成本测算对比

假设每日运行24小时,连续30天:

实例类型单价(元/小时)日成本月成本
A100 标准实例6.8163.24,896
A100 Spot实例2.150.41,512

每月节省高达 3,384 元,降幅达69.1%!

数据来源:CSDN AI云平台2025年Q1定价

4.2 提升服务稳定性的三大技巧

技巧一:添加健康检查端点

修改app.py添加轻量级健康检查接口:

@app.route('/healthz', methods=['GET']) def health_check(): return {'status': 'healthy', 'model': 'HY-MT1.5-1.8B'}, 200

可用于负载均衡器或Kubernetes探针判断服务状态。

技巧二:启用模型加载缓存

在Docker启动时挂载tmpfs内存盘加速加载:

--mount type=tmpfs,destination=/tmp/models,tmpfs-size=4000000000

并将模型复制至内存中运行,减少IO延迟。

技巧三:结合对象存储做冷备

使用COS/S3等对象存储保存模型副本:

# 下载模型(首次) aws s3 cp s3://my-model-bucket/HY-MT1.5-1.8B/ /data/hy-mt-models/ --recursive

避免因本地磁盘丢失导致长时间不可用。

5. 性能监控与调优建议

5.1 关键性能指标监控

部署后应持续关注以下指标:

指标告警阈值监控方式
GPU利用率>90%持续5minPrometheus + Node Exporter
请求延迟P95>500ms日志埋点 + Grafana
容器重启频率>3次/天Docker Events + Slack告警
显存占用>90%nvidia-smi轮询

推荐使用Prometheus+Grafana搭建可视化监控面板。

5.2 推理参数调优建议

根据实际业务需求调整生成参数以平衡质量与速度:

{ "max_new_tokens": 1024, "temperature": 0.7, "top_p": 0.9, "repetition_penalty": 1.1 }
  • 高并发场景:降低max_new_tokens至512,提升吞吐量
  • 高质量要求:提高top_p并启用beam search(num_beams=4
  • 防重复输出:适当增加repetition_penalty(1.05~1.2)

6. 总结

6. 总结

本文详细介绍了如何通过Spot实例 + Docker容器 + 自动恢复脚本的组合方式,低成本部署腾讯混元HY-MT1.5-1.8B翻译模型。相比传统标准实例部署,该方案可实现近70%的成本节约,同时通过合理的架构设计保障了服务的基本可用性。

核心要点回顾: 1.Spot实例是降本利器:适用于可容忍短时中断的AI推理服务; 2.容器化提升可移植性:Docker封装简化部署流程; 3.自动重启机制弥补不稳定性:shell循环脚本即可实现基础容灾; 4.持久化存储与缓存优化:减少冷启动时间,提升用户体验; 5.监控与调优不可或缺:确保服务长期稳定运行。

未来可进一步探索: - 使用Kubernetes管理Spot节点池,实现弹性伸缩 - 结合Serverless框架按需启停实例 - 多区域部署提升容灾能力

对于中小企业和开发者而言,善用Spot资源是迈向AI工程化落地的关键一步。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 11:33:39

FutureRestore深度解析:iOS设备固件降级与恢复的终极指南

FutureRestore深度解析&#xff1a;iOS设备固件降级与恢复的终极指南 【免费下载链接】futurerestore A hacked up idevicerestore wrapper, which allows specifying SEP and Baseband for restoring 项目地址: https://gitcode.com/gh_mirrors/fut/futurerestore Futu…

作者头像 李华
网站建设 2026/6/10 10:23:19

QRemeshify完整教程:从三角面到高质量四边形的终极转换方案

QRemeshify完整教程&#xff1a;从三角面到高质量四边形的终极转换方案 【免费下载链接】QRemeshify A Blender extension for an easy-to-use remesher that outputs good-quality quad topology 项目地址: https://gitcode.com/gh_mirrors/qr/QRemeshify 在3D建模的世…

作者头像 李华
网站建设 2026/6/9 23:38:37

IndexTTS2 V23实测:云端GPU 3小时深度体验仅需3块钱

IndexTTS2 V23实测&#xff1a;云端GPU 3小时深度体验仅需3块钱 你是不是也遇到过这种情况&#xff1a;看到一个超火的AI语音合成项目&#xff0c;比如最近很火的 IndexTTS2 V23&#xff0c;支持情感控制、音色克隆&#xff0c;还能通过WebUI一键操作&#xff0c;听起来特别高…

作者头像 李华
网站建设 2026/6/10 11:45:16

IINA播放器终极指南:macOS平台最强大的视频播放解决方案

IINA播放器终极指南&#xff1a;macOS平台最强大的视频播放解决方案 【免费下载链接】iina 项目地址: https://gitcode.com/gh_mirrors/iin/iina IINA作为macOS平台上基于mpv引擎的现代视频播放器&#xff0c;为苹果用户提供了无与伦比的视频播放体验。这款免费开源的播…

作者头像 李华
网站建设 2026/6/10 1:03:47

万物识别-中文-通用领域完整指南:高效运行推理.py的三大关键步骤

万物识别-中文-通用领域完整指南&#xff1a;高效运行推理.py的三大关键步骤 在当前多模态AI快速发展的背景下&#xff0c;图像理解能力已成为智能系统的核心组成部分。万物识别-中文-通用领域模型由阿里开源&#xff0c;专注于中文语境下的细粒度图像内容识别任务&#xff0c…

作者头像 李华
网站建设 2026/6/10 11:40:21

Qwen3-4B部署提效50%:基于4090D的参数调优实战案例

Qwen3-4B部署提效50%&#xff1a;基于4090D的参数调优实战案例 1. 背景与挑战 随着大模型在实际业务场景中的广泛应用&#xff0c;如何高效部署中等规模模型&#xff08;如Qwen3-4B&#xff09;成为工程团队关注的核心问题。尽管4090D显卡具备强大的单卡推理能力&#xff08;…

作者头像 李华